** The plumbing market serving Burton, Texas, is characteristic of a rural community with a mix of local, long-standing operators and established companies from the nearby commercial center of Brenham. The competition is moderate, with a strong emphasis on reputation and word-of-mouth referrals, which is common in close-knit communities. Service quality is generally high, as contractors rely heavily on their local reputation. The market includes specialists in agricultural, residential, and light commercial plumbing. Typical pricing is in line with regional Texas averages. A standard service call fee ranges from $75 - $150, with emergency/after-hours rates being higher. Hourly labor rates typically fall between $80 - $130 per hour. For larger projects like water heater replacement, customers can expect to pay between $1,200 - $2,500+, and sewer line repairs can range from $2,000 to $10,000+ depending on the depth and method of repair (traditional trenching vs. trenchless). Given the age of some properties in the historic Burton area, expertise in dealing with older pipe materials (like galvanized steel) is a valued asset among local providers.
